High-Current Terminal Block Overview

A high-current terminal block is engineered to carry main power conductors — typically 35 mm² to 185 mm² cable — at currents from 150 A to 400 A continuous, while still fitting on a standard TS-35 DIN rail. The wide, deep clamping chambers accommodate large stranded conductors and lugged cables, and the silver-plated contact surfaces minimize resistance heating at high current density.

Fenglan's high-current blocks are available in single-conductor and twin-conductor versions, with optional knife-disconnect isolator for each pole, and are rated at 1,000 V DC (suitable for solar main busbars) and 1,000 V AC for industrial three-phase main feeds. Every block is tested at 2× rated current for 1 hour as part of batch qualification.

Specification

Conductor Range35 mm² – 185 mm² (AWG 2 – 350 kcmil)
Current Rating150 A (35 mm²) — 400 A (185 mm²) continuous
Voltage Rating1,000 V AC / 1,000 V DC
Clamping MethodScrew-clamp with high-torque hex socket bolt
Torque (185 mm²)30 N·m (requires 8 mm hex key)
Contact MaterialSilver-plated copper alloy — maintains low resistance at high clamping torque
Housing Width35 mm (35 mm²) — 90 mm (185 mm²) on TS-35 DIN rail
Housing MaterialUL94 V-0 glass-filled PA66 — higher thermal stability vs standard PA66
Conductor Entry AngleHorizontal side-entry; lug entry with M8/M10 stud option on 150 A+
Disconnect OptionKnife-disconnect isolating blade (optional) between left and right conductor
Temperature Rise (rated current)≤ 50 K above ambient (per IEC 60947-7-1 test)
Short-Circuit Rating10 kA rms for 1 s (with upstream 125 A breaker)
DIN RailTS-35 standard; TS-32 adapter for 185 mm²
StandardsIEC 60947-7-1; IEC 61439; CE; RoHS

Application

High-current terminal blocks are used at the power inlet and main distribution points of large control panels and distribution boards:

  • Main panel incoming feed — connection of incoming mains cable (35–185 mm²) to panel busbars or main breaker
  • Motor control center busbars — horizontal busbar feed distribution to vertical MCC sections
  • Large motor branch circuits — direct connection of 90–250 kW motor supply cables to contactor and overload terminals
  • Generator paralleling panels — main incoming terminal for generator output cables before the paralleling breaker
  • Transformer secondary terminals — LV winding output connection in dry-type and oil transformer secondary cabinets
  • Solar inverter DC input — main PV array cable termination at inverter DC input terminal block (up to 1,000 V DC)
  • Battery energy storage systems — main DC bus cable connection between battery racks and the inverter/BMS

Advantage

  • High current on standard DIN rail — carries up to 400 A without busbars or specialized enclosures — keeps panel design simple and uniform
  • Silver-plated contacts — silver plating maintains low contact resistance over years of thermal cycling, preventing hot spots at high current density
  • 1,000 V AC and DC rated — single product family covers both AC industrial panels and DC solar/battery systems
  • Knife-disconnect option — optional built-in isolating blade allows single-pole isolation of main cables during maintenance without fully de-energizing the panel
  • Hex-socket bolt clamping — high-torque hex socket bolt (30 N·m on largest size) provides far better clamping reliability than standard slotted or cross-head screws on large conductors
  • Batch current tested — every production batch is tested at 2× rated current for 1 hour — thermal and contact resistance verified before shipment
